Laurent Condon, a retired trader in Saint-Rambert-en-Bugey, France, won my stock picking contest, Dorfman’s Three-Stock Derby, for 2019-2020. “I think the stock market is not going to print a new high price before a very long time, probably several years,” he says. He had a 619% gain on Kodiak Sciences (KOD), an 89% gain on a short sale of Ocean Power Technologies (OPTT) and a 94% gain on a short sale of Yangtze River Port and Logistics Ltd. (YRIV). A short sale is, in essence, a bet that a stock will decline. The second-place and third-place finishers also think the market faces at least a couple more months of rough going, though they are more optimistic than Condon.
